Ogden, Iowa
Ogden is a city in Boone County, Iowa, United States. The population was 2,023 at the 2000 census. It is part of the 'Boone, Iowa Micropolitan Statistical Area', which is a part of the larger 'Ames-Boone, Iowa Combined Statistical Area'.

Ogden Careers
Among the most common occupations in Ogden are Sales and office occupations, 25%. Management, professional, and related occupations, 21%. and Production, transportation, and material moving occupations, 21%. Approximately 69 percent of workers in Ogden, Iowa work for companies, 20 percent work for the government and 10 percent are self-employed.

Ogden Industries
The leading industries in Ogden, Iowa are Educational, health and social services, 25%; Retail trade, 14%; and Manufacturing, 10%. Simply Hired's Ogden job listings indicate that the following industries in Ogden are hiring the most workers:
Pesticide & Herbicide Mfg, Nursery & Garden Stores, Farm Supplies Wholesalers, Clinics & Outpatient Services and Automotive Chemicals Mfg.
Ogden Job Salaries
According to government data, the average salary for jobs in Ogden, Iowa is $27,366, and the median income of households in Ogden was $41,114.
Ogden Unemployment Rate
Ogden has an unemployment rate of 1.0%, compared the national average of 5.8%.
